Master the art of stunning flower photography with your DSLR, bridge or mirrorless camera. As well as demystifying the essential camera controls, Anna will explain how to “see” the picture, using light and composition to create atmospheric images that go beyond the snapshot. You’ll leave armed with specific techniques for capturing the delicate beauty of flowers in exciting new ways
Camera skill level – beginner to intermediate. This course is suitable for DSLR, bridge or mirrorless cameras, but not phones or tablets. Further details will be sent out prior to the course.

About the Speaker
Anna Saverimuttu
Guildford resident, Anna Saverimuttu, has been a professional photographer for over 25 years, working across genres including corporate portraiture, families, events and PR. She also runs beginners’ photography workshops, helping students to easily master their cameras.
When engaged in personal work, Anna’s inspiration comes from photographing the natural world, especially flowers and plants. Her approach involves creatively capturing their shapes, colours and textures through the precise use of light and composition, combined with an understanding of the camera controls that will yield the best results.
For Anna, her camera is a means of connecting with nature on a more meaningful level by conveying mood and atmosphere and what Aristotle described as “inward significance” rather than merely showing “the outward appearance of things.”
She believes that photography should be taught simply and clearly so students can get past the technical barriers and fully immerse themselves in the creative process.
